George Mitchell brought in to mediate PG&E dispute over San Bruno damages, Warriors unveil preliminary arena design, UC Berkeley dean shocked over law students’ arrest for killing bird, more.
- Former U. S. Senator George Mitchell has been brought in to mediate talks between state regulators and PG&E over the utility’s financial liability for the San Bruno disaster. Chronicle
- The Warriors unveiled a preliminary design for the arena they’re trying to build on San Francisco’s waterfront. SF Business Times
- The dean of UC Berkeley’s law school says he’s “extremely troubled” by the arrest of two law students for allegedly beheading an exotic bird in Las Vegas. Chronicle
- District 5 supervisorial candidate Julian Davis calls allegations that he groped a woman six years ago politically motivated. Chronicle
- Police say a stabbing near Candlestick Park before the 49ers game Sunday was sparked by the victim’s wearing a Dallas Cowboys jersey. AP
